**Q: Does the Pernwick admin dashboard support dark mode?**

Yep! Toggle it under Appearance in your profile settings — it syncs across sessions. If the toggle is greyed out, your theme cache is locked and needs a reset, which asks for the team recovery passphrase, noted right below for convenience.

recovery phrase for bawep-kawef: oliath-casdor

# Records are matched on normalized name plus postal fragment; a
# fuzzy pass catches transposed characters. Matches above the 0.92
# threshold merge automatically, everything between 0.80 and 0.92
# lands in the review queue. Do not lower the auto-merge threshold
# without checking the false-positive report first — past attempts
# merged unrelated households. Merge decisions are logged for six
# months and are reversible via the admin tool. The dedupe service
# connects to its backing store using the string below.

replica DSN, kajep-yahag: mssql://praok_svc:iF@db-8d68.plorvaio.local:5432/eliion

Release checklist — item 7: health checks behind the Kestrelgate load balancer. Before promoting, confirm the new /ready endpoint returns 200 only after the cache warmer finishes; the old endpoint lied during warmup and the balancer routed traffic into cold nodes, which caused the Brindle launch wobble. Verify drain timeout is set above the warmer's worst-case duration, and that both availability zones report healthy independently. Reviewer should sign off only after comparing the deployed artifact against the reference noted below.

trace token, yafog-bafop: htk31_90e4e3962168bb1bf8de5dfe86ea527

# RateMirror parity client setup.
# Polls the internal FareLedger service for published room rates across
# the Quillhaven property set, then diffs against channel snapshots.
# Poll interval is 15 min; shorter intervals trip FareLedger throttling
# and the whole parity run aborts, so leave it alone. Snapshot cache
# lives in /var/ratemirror and is safe to wipe between runs. Known
# quirk: suite-tier rates lag by one cycle; handled downstream, don't
# patch here. The client authenticates to FareLedger with the key below.

gateway credential: kto3_qfe